Eviction Filings and Defaults in Delaware

During the COVID-19 pandemic, there was a state-wide moratorium on evictions from March 17, 2020 to July 1, 2020.

The CDC moratorium was in place from September 4, 2020 through August 26, 2021.

About the Data

Please cite the data as: Civil Court Data Initiative. Legal Services Corporation, 2022. (accessed TODAY’s DATE).

Cases filed under a case type containing any of the following terms or with any of the following event information are considered evictions: 61 - JP LANDLORD TENANT, MY - WRIT OF POSSESSION, CI - EJECTMENT

Census data comes from the following 2021 American Community Survey (ACS) 5-year tables: B25070 (rent burden), B25032 (housing units), and B25008 (renter and total population).
